cams espeically 280s will never be covered by warrenty. 280s most of the time require the springs and retainers to be replacced in the head as well.

Just go search how bad mitsu is with warrentys they will void it for any reason they can. You just have to go to the right one. My dealer didnt viod mine after looking at it but I hid the SAFC inside the dash when I brought it in.

he means it depends on what dealerships you go to when getting warrenty work done on it. Like say something breaks like a t-case. And the dealer says they wont warrenty it because you have a boost controller or exhaust. Well some dealer will, and some wont. It depends on how picky they get.
